You need to be careful when using zen enclosures, well any prebuilt ones at that. I bought the two ten inch enclosure for my car. I was not to keen on a single space for both subs but at the time I do not have the ability to build my own box.The shared space was going to be quite a bit smaller than what the subs called for and figured it still might be enough. Needless to say I was not getting much sound out of them and decided to take advantage of the single space. So I mounted them in a isobaric load which actually made the space in the box a tad bit larger than spec with that type of load but it worked out well.
I am thinking of ditching this setup for a ib setup or isobaric ib setup. I have not decided yet on what I will do.
